As we get closer to spring you may want to consider starting seeds indoors, to get a jump on planting your garden. This can include planting seeds in paper cups or egg cartons to using commercially available products.
Buying plants at a nursery has gotten quite expensive and starting your own seeds can be much cheaper. You can buy seeds at a store or by mail, or you can carry seeds over from last year, including heirloom seeds. There are also seed libraries and seed swaps available in our community.
This webinar will cover all the topics plus much more!
